    I went back to Roadfit to have the tint checked kasi may nga bubbles sa 2nd row window and meron isa sa windshield. I was hoping na i-heat gun nila para mawala pero they decided to replace the tint.

    I can live with the tiny bubble sa windshield pero they recommended it to be replaced na lang. Medyo nanghihinayang ako nun una kasi nakadikit na yung dashcam ko. Pero naisip ko, nahihirapan ako sa VLT 20 during nighttime.

    Since irereplace nila, I asked if pwede gawin lighter yun tint. They agreed and installed a VLT 35 on the windshield. Yun visibility ngayon during nighttime is now better Sunbloc Tint

    Even though hassle, yung nangyari, it is for the best. Though it sounds like a shameless plug, I'm still one happy customer sa RoadFit. It takes balls to decide to replace yun tint ah.

    PS. Ngayon ko lang nalaman ang Sunbloc is from Korea pala.
